IED is proud to participate in the 2026 National Portfolio Day (NPD) series — a key opportunity for prospective students to receive direct feedback on their portfolios, learn about creative pathways, and explore educational opportunities with leading design institutions.
This year, IED representatives will be present at the following dates and formats:
April 25, 2026 — Online
May 9, 2026 — Online
National Portfolio Day events are designed to support aspiring creatives as they prepare for higher education in design, art, fashion, communication and beyond. Attendees can present their work, ask questions about the application process, and connect one-to-one with admissions advisors from participating schools.
What to Expect
At each National Portfolio Day event, IED staff will:
Offer personalised portfolio reviews with constructive, real-time feedback.
Share insights into IED’s programme offerings, admissions criteria, and creative expectations.
Provide guidance on how to strengthen applications and prepare for study in a global design environment.
